HUDCO announces Potential Loan Assistance worth Rs 1 Lakh Crore under PMAY-U 2.0
HUDCO was registered as a Non-Banking Financial Company – Infrastructure Finance Company by RBI.
The Housing and Urban Development Corporation Limited (HUDCO) has declared its potential to extend loan assistance between Rs 75,000 crore and Rs 1 lakh crore under the Pradhan Mantri Awas Yojana -Urban 2.0 (PMAY -U 2.0) scheme.
HUDCO has been appointed as one of the Central Nodal Agencies (CNA) to channel interest subsidy and as one of the technical institutions to conduct Desk-cum-Site Scrutiny of the projects under the PMAY-U 2.0 scheme.
The company has stated that the PMAY-U 2.0 scheme guidelines will also create significant opportunities for HUDCO in the areas of consultancy and capacity-building.
